AccessTr.neT
64 Bit Hatası Hakıkında - Baskı Önizleme

+- AccessTr.neT (https://accesstr.net)
+-- Forum: Microsoft Access (https://accesstr.net/forum-microsoft-access.html)
+--- Forum: Access Cevaplanmış Soruları (https://accesstr.net/forum-access-cevaplanmis-sorulari.html)
+--- Konu Başlığı: 64 Bit Hatası Hakıkında (/konu-64-bit-hatasi-hakikinda.html)



64 Bit Hatası Hakıkında - hyavuz - 06/12/2010

Arkadaşlar yemi bilgisayarım 64 bit ve kullanmış olduğum programda aşağıdaki hatayı alıyorum. neyapmam gerekir.
Teşekkürler..

[Resim: 63xirl.jpg]


Cvp: 64 Bit Hatası Hakıkında - ozanakkaya - 06/12/2010

koddaki Long yerine LongPtr yaz. Düzelmezse PtrSafe olayına girelim


Cvp: 64 Bit Hatası Hakıkında - hyavuz - 06/12/2010

Hepsini değiştirdim ama Long olanları LongPtr yaptım aynı hatayı veriyor. Img-cray

(06/12/2010, 12:00)sledgeab yazdı: koddaki Long yerine LongPtr yaz. Düzelmezse PtrSafe olayına girelim




Cvp: 64 Bit Hatası Hakıkında - mustafa_atr - 06/12/2010

Dostum şurayı bir oku belki faydalı olur
Birde "www.thecodecage.com/forumz/members-word-vb-programming/116980-[solved]-add-x64-ptrsafe-macro-allow-run-x64-word-2010-a.html" adresinde seninkine benzer bir konu tartışılmış onuda bir oku


Cvp: 64 Bit Hatası Hakıkında - alpeki99 - 06/12/2010

Sadece LongPtr yeterli olmayacaktır. Kodunuzda :

Declare Function

olan bölümü

Declare PtrSafe Function

şekline getirmeniz gerekmektedir. İşin komik ötesi yanı bu defa aynı programı 32 Bit işletim sistemi ve Ofis ile kullanacak olursanız yine hata alacaksınız. Bunun yerine programı yazarken her iki işletim sistemini düşünüp ona göre kodlama yapmanız gerekmektedir.

Bunun için kodlama yöntemleri var ancak Access'in bize yapmış olduğu en büyük yanlış bu tip problemlere yol açmasıdır.